I have a 2001 A3 1.8t with 36,500 miles which I bought a few weeks ago. I have noticed that there is a vibration through the steering wheel when I lift off the accelerator when above 80 mph.

At first I thought it was wheel balancing, but would that not cause vibrations when accelerating as well as decelerating?

I am now starting to think that it is something to do with the engine as when I lift off at 80 I get the vibration through the wheel and can feel it through the car as well and it also kind of sounds like the engine is gurgling - weird I know, but it is the only way I can describe it!

Does anyone have any ideas what might be causing it?
 
Check your engine mounts as one coould have failed.
